Engineered To Maximize Output And Clarity, Ernie Ball Cobalt Slinky Guitar Strings Are One Of The Latest Innovations In String Technology. Seeking To Provide Guitarists And Bassists With A New Voice, Cobalt Strings Provide An Extended Dynamic Range, Incredible Harmonic Response, Increased Low End, And Crisp, Clear Highs. Cobalt Provides A Stronger Magnetic Relationship Between Pickups And Strings Than Any Other Alloy Previously Available.

Q: What materials are used in Ernie Ball Hybrid Slinky Cobalt Electric Guitar Strings?A: These strings are made from Cobalt alloy wrapped around a tin-plated high-carbon steel core wire. This combination enhances magnetic response and sound clarity.
Q: What is the gauge of Ernie Ball Hybrid Slinky Cobalt Electric Guitar Strings?A: The gauge is nine to forty-six, known as Hybrid (9-46). This set combines lower tension for high strings and thicker low strings.
